In my view this "foundation" has nothing to do with auDA's purpose.

Obviously the whole thing is in limbo but registrants are still contributing money towards it (25 cents per registration), why should they?

The foundation has $2.4 million in the bank and that money should either go back to auDA or back to registrants.

The auDA Foundation needs to be investigated and audited independently going back to before it was set up and why, how it has been run, who has received grants and why.

It needs to be shut down and .au domain name registrants given the discount by lower wholesale pricing.

Yes many of the grant recipients are worthy causes but they should seek funding from other places. They in many cases have nothing to do with what auDA's job is which is the manage the .au namespace.

Description of charity’s activities and outcomes
The auDA Foundation is a charitable trust that was established in 2005 to provide grants for projects for the purpose of promoting and encouraging educational and research activities that will ultimately enhance the utility of the Internet for the benefit of the Australian community.
